Skip to content

This is the repository for the collection of satellite network simulators.


Notifications You must be signed in to change notification settings


Folders and files

Last commit message
Last commit date

Latest commit



19 Commits

Repository files navigation


This is the repository for the collection of satellite network simulators.

If you find this repository helpful, you may consider cite our relevant work:

  • Jiang W, Han H, He M, et al. When game theory meets satellite communication networks: A survey[J]. Computer Communications, 2024. Link
  • Jiang W, et al. Federated split learning for sequential data in satellite-terrestrial integrated networks[J]. Information Fusion, 2023. Link
  • Jiang W. Software defined satellite networks: A survey[J]. Digital Communications and Networks, 2023. Link
  • Jiang W, et al. Network Simulators for Satellite-Terrestrial Integrated Networks: A Survey. IEEE Access, 2023. Link
  • Jiang W, et al. Multi-Domain Network Slicing in Satellite–Terrestrial Integrated Networks: A Multi-Sided Ascending-Price Auction Approach. Aerospace 2023, 10(10), 830. Link
  • Liu J, Jiang W, Han H, et al. Satellite Internet of Things for Smart Agriculture Applications: A Case Study of Computer Vision[C]//2023 20th Annual IEEE International Conference on Sensing, Communication, and Networking (SECON). IEEE, 2023: 66-71. Link

Advertisement: 欢迎大家关注我的微信公众号或知乎账号,都叫“网络与通信”,会定期推送网络与通信领域会议截止日期汇总、开源代码论文汇总等推文。

Liteature Review

Relevant Projects


  • Universitat Politècnica de Catalunya · BarcelonaTech BACHELOR DEGREE THESIS: Virtual Satellite Network Simulator (VSNeS) - A Novel Engine to Evaluate Satellite Networks Over Virtual Infrastructure and Networks Link

Other Surveys

  • Yastrebova A, Anttonen A, Lasanen M, et al. Interoperable simulation tools for satellite networks[C]//2021 IEEE 22nd International Symposium on a World of Wireless, Mobile and Multimedia Networks (WoWMoM). IEEE, 2021: 304-309. Link


  • Puddu R, Popescu V, Murroni M. An open source satellite network simulator for quality based multimedia broadband traffic management[C]//2022 IEEE International Symposium on Broadband Multimedia Systems and Broadcasting (BMSB). IEEE, 2022: 01-07. Link
  • Kon P T J, Barradas D, Chen A. Stargaze: A LEO Constellation Emulator for Security Experimentation[C]//Proceedings of the 4th Workshop on CPS & IoT Security and Privacy. 2022: 47-53. Link Code
  • Puddu R, Popescu V, Murroni M. An Open Source Simulator for Next Generation Satellite Broadband Traffic Management[C]//2022 IEEE Aerospace Conference (AERO). IEEE, 2022: 1-6. Link
  • Kodheli O, Querol J, Astro A, et al. 5G Space Communications Lab: Reaching New Heights[C]//2022 18th International Conference on Distributed Computing in Sensor Systems (DCOSS). IEEE, 2022: 349-356. Link Website
  • Afhamisis M, Barillaro S, Palattella M R. A Testbed for LoRaWAN Satellite Backhaul: Design Principles and Validation[C]//2022 IEEE International Conference on Communications Workshops (ICC Workshops). IEEE, 2022: 1171-1176. Link
  • Fraire J A, Madoery P, Mesbah M A, et al. Simulating LoRa-Based Direct-to-Satellite IoT Networks with FLoRaSat[C]//2022 IEEE 23rd International Symposium on a World of Wireless, Mobile and Multimedia Networks (WoWMoM). IEEE, 2022: 464-470. Link Code Gitlab Link
  • Celestial: Pfandzelter T, Bermbach D. Celestial: Virtual Software System Testbeds for the LEO Edge[J]. arXiv preprint arXiv:2204.06282, 2022. Link GitHub Link
  • Pfandzelter T, Bermbach D. QoS-Aware Resource Placement for LEO Satellite Edge Computing[J]. arXiv preprint arXiv:2201.05872, 2022. Link GitHub Link
  • SMN Simulator: Kim J, Lee J, Ko H, et al. Space Mobile Networks: Satellite as Core and Access Networks for B5G[J]. IEEE Communications Magazine, 2022, 60(4): 58-64. Link GitHub Link


  • Zhang Q, Hou D, Kuang C, et al. A Large-Scale Emulation Method of AOS Protocol Based on Space Network Emulation Platform[C]//International Conference on Wireless and Satellite Systems. Springer, Cham, 2021: 237-243. Link
  • Zhang Y, Wang B, Guo B, et al. A research on integrated space-ground information network simulation platform based on SDN[J]. Computer Networks, 2021, 188: 107821. Link
  • Puttonen J, Sormunen L, Martikainen H, et al. A System Simulator for 5G Non-Terrestrial Network Evaluations[C]//2021 IEEE 22nd International Symposium on a World of Wireless, Mobile and Multimedia Networks (WoWMoM). IEEE, 2021: 292-297. Link
  • Järvinen R, Puttonen J, Alhava J, et al. A system simulator for Broadband Global Area Network[C]//38th International Communications Satellite Systems Conference (ICSSC 2021). IET, 2021, 2021: 38-44. Link
  • Mendoza F, Minardi M, Chatzinotas S, et al. An SDN Based Testbed for Dynamic Network Slicing in Satellite-Terrestrial Networks[C]//2021 IEEE International Mediterranean Conference on Communications and Networking (MeditCom). IEEE, 2021: 36-41. Link
  • Li J, Hua N, Zhao C, et al. Design and Implementation of Open Optical Satellite Network Emulation Platform (OOSN-EP) Based on Distributed Multi-Node System[C]//Optoelectronics and Communications Conference. Optical Society of America, 2021: JS2A. 7. Link
  • Valentine A, Parisis G. Developing and experimenting with LEO satellite constellations in OMNeT++[J]. arXiv preprint arXiv:2109.12046, 2021. Link GitHub Link
  • Quadrini M. Development of a testing emulation platform for the validation and design of 5G satellite services[C]//2021 4th International Symposium on Advanced Electrical and Communication Technologies (ISAECT). IEEE, 2021: 01-05. Link
  • Petersen E, López J, Kushik N, et al. Dynamic Link Network Emulation: a Model-based Design[J]. arXiv preprint arXiv:2107.07217, 2021. (Note: Old version paper name as Satellite Communication Digital Twin for Evaluating Novel Solutions: Dynamic Link Emulation Architecture) Link GitHub Link
  • Pfandzelter T, Bermbach D. Edge (of the Earth) Replication: Optimizing Content Delivery in Large LEO Satellite Communication Networks[C]//2021 IEEE/ACM 21st International Symposium on Cluster, Cloud and Internet Computing (CCGrid). IEEE, 2021: 565-575. Link GitHub Link
  • Freimann A, Dierkes M, Petermann T, et al. ESTNeT: a discrete event simulator for space-terrestrial networks[J]. CEAS Space Journal, 2021, 13(1): 39-49. Link GitHub Link
  • Höyhtyä M, Majanen M, Hoppari M, et al. Licensed shared access field trial and a testbed for satellite‐terrestrial communication including research directions for 5G and beyond[J]. International Journal of Satellite Communications and Networking, 2021, 39(4): 455-472. Link
  • Lai J, Tian J, Zhang K, et al. Network emulation as a service (neaas): Towards a cloud-based network emulation platform[J]. Mobile Networks and Applications, 2021, 26(2): 766-780. Link
  • SILLEO-SCNS: Kempton B, Riedl A. Network Simulator for Large Low Earth Orbit Satellite Networks[C]//ICC 2021-IEEE International Conference on Communications. IEEE, 2021: 1-6. Link GitHub Link
  • SatSysSim: Iida R F, Trindade P H A, Faria B, et al. SatSysSim: A Novel Event-Driven Simulation Framework for DVB/RCS2 Performance Characterization[J]. IEEE Access, 2021, 10: 308-318. Link
  • Vehkaperä M, Hoppari M, Suomalainen J, et al. Testbed for Local-Area Private Network with Satellite-Terrestrial Backhauling[C]//2021 International Conference on Electrical, Communication, and Computer Engineering (ICECCE). IEEE, 2021: 1-6. Link
  • Chen F, Zhou W, Zhao K, et al. The Development of a Lightweight Network Emulator for Large-Scale Space Network Emulation[C]//International Conference on Wireless and Satellite Systems. Springer, Cham, 2021: 289-298. Link
  • Petrosino A, Sciddurlo G, Martiradonna S, et al. WIP: An Open-Source Tool for Evaluating System-Level Performance of NB-IoT Non-Terrestrial Networks[C]//2021 IEEE 22nd International Symposium on a World of Wireless, Mobile and Multimedia Networks (WoWMoM). IEEE, 2021: 236-239. Link
  • Trunks, a lightweight DVB-S2/RCS2 satellite system simulator. GitHub Link


  • Wei J, Cao S, Pan S, et al. SatEdgeSim: A toolkit for modeling and simulation of performance evaluation in satellite edge computing environments[C]//2020 12th International Conference on Communication Software and Networks (ICCSN). IEEE, 2020: 307-313. Link Code
  • Deutschmann J, Hielscher K S J, German R. An ns-3 model for multipath communication with terrestrial and satellite links[C]//Measurement, Modelling and Evaluation of Computing Systems: 20th International GI/ITG Conference, MMB 2020, Saarbrücken, Germany, March 16–18, 2020, Proceedings 20. Springer International Publishing, 2020: 65-81. Link Github Link
  • Cheng N, Quan W, Shi W, et al. A comprehensive simulation platform for space-air-ground integrated network[J]. IEEE Wireless Communications, 2020, 27(1): 178-185. Link
  • SGIN-Stack: Wang X, Chen X, Ye H, et al. Cloud-based experimental platform for the space-ground integrated network[J]. Wireless Communications and Mobile Computing, 2020, 2020. Link
  • Hypatia: Kassing S, Bhattacherjee D, Águas A B, et al. Exploring the" Internet from space" with Hypatia[C]//Proceedings of the ACM Internet Measurement Conference. 2020: 214-229. Link GitHub Link
  • LSNS: Liu M, Gui Y, Li J, et al. Large-Scale Small Satellite Network Simulator: Design and Evaluation[C]//2020 3rd International Conference on Hot Information-Centric Networking (HotICN). IEEE, 2020: 194-199. Link GitHub Link
  • MininetE: Lin T, Chen F, Zhao K, et al. MininetE: a lightweight emulator for space information networks[C]//International Conference on Wireless and Satellite Systems. Springer, Cham, 2020: 48-57. Link
  • spacecraft-ns3: Evans J M, Black J, Doyle D. Spacecraft Discrete-Event Network Simulator[M]//ASCEND 2020. 2020: 4220. Link
  • Al-Hraishawi H, Lagunas E, Chatzinotas S. Traffic simulator for multibeam satellite communication systems[C]//2020 10th Advanced Satellite Multimedia Systems Conference and the 16th Signal Processing for Space Communications Workshop (ASMS/SPSC). IEEE, 2020: 1-8. Link


  • Leoni A, Nannipieri P, Davalle D, et al. Shine: Simulator for satellite on-board high-speed networks featuring spacefibre and spacewire protocols[J]. Aerospace, 2019, 6(4): 43. Link
  • Guo X, Guo B, Li K, et al. A SDN-enabled Integrated Space-Ground Information Network Simulation Platform[C]//2019 18th International Conference on Optical Communications and Networks (ICOCN). IEEE, 2019: 1-3. Link
  • Li K, Guo B, Huang S, et al. A Simulation Platform for Software Defined Integrated Space Ground Network[C]//2019 IEEE 11th International Conference on Advanced Infocomm Technology (ICAIT). IEEE, 2019: 118-123. Link


  • Qin J, Dong T, Guo Q, et al. Dynamic simulation platform for software defined optical satellite networking[C]//Fiber Optic Sensing and Optical Communication. International Society for Optics and Photonics, 2018, 10849: 1084911. Link


  • Fraire J A, Madoery P, Raverta F, et al. Dtnsim: Bridging the gap between simulation and implementation of space-terrestrial dtns[C]//2017 6th International Conference on Space Mission Challenges for Information Technology (SMC-IT). IEEE, 2017: 120-123. Link Bitbucket Link
  • OpenSatNet: Fei C, Zhao B, Yu W, et al. A research platform for software defined satellite networks[C]//2017 16th International Conference on Optical Communications and Networks (ICOCN). IEEE, 2017: 1-2. Link
  • OpenSAND, an open source satcom Emulator. Webpage GitHub Link
  • TFM, Multibeam Fixed-Satellite Service Simulator. Github Link


  • Lu T, Zhang W, Ni X, et al. A scalable network emulation architecture for space internetworking[C]//2016 IEEE International Conference on Communication Systems (ICCS). IEEE, 2016: 1-5. Link
  • Cogswel: Barnes J L, Clark G J, Eddy W. Cogswel: A network emulator for cognitive space networks[C]//34th AIAA International Communications Satellite Systems Conference. 2016: 5763. Link
  • He L, Zhang X, Cheng Z, et al. Design and implementation of SDN/IP hybrid space information network prototype[C]//2016 IEEE/CIC International Conference on Communications in China (ICCC Workshops). IEEE, 2016: 1-6. Link
  • ns-3 satellite mobility model. GitHub Link or GitLab Link


  • SNS3: Puttonen J, Rantanen S, Laakso F, et al. Satellite model for network simulator 3[C]//SimuTools. 2014: 86-91. Link Webpage


  • OS3: Niehoefer B, Šubik S, Wietfeld C. The cni open source satellite simulator based on omnet++[C]//Proceedings of the 6th International ICST Conference on Simulation Tools and Techniques. 2013: 314-321. Link Webpage


  • SATSIM: Bodin P, Nylund M, Battelino M. SATSIM—A real-time multi-satellite simulator for test and validation in formation flying projects[J]. Acta Astronautica, 2012, 74: 29-39. Link


This is the repository for the collection of satellite network simulators.







No releases published


No packages published